首页 | 本学科首页   官方微博 | 高级检索  
     

基于哈希链的序列密码算法
引用本文:姜璇,李永珍.基于哈希链的序列密码算法[J].延边大学理工学报,2015,0(3):249-253.
作者姓名:姜璇  李永珍
作者单位:延边大学工学院 计算机科学与技术学科 网络与安全研究室, 吉林 延吉 133002
摘    要:为了设计出能应用于无线移动通信的序列密码算法,提出了一种将单分组散列函数应用于哈希链方法的序列密码算法(SC-SBH).该算法首先用哈希链的方法对单分组散列函数进行循环运算,将运算的每一次结果值输出后连接成序列密码的密钥序列,然后将明文与密钥序列进行按位异或运算得到密文.实现SC-SBH算法后,对其安全性和随机性进行了测试,并将其运行效率与SC-MD5和SC-SHA算法进行了比较.实验结果表明,SC-SBH算法在加密方面不仅能够保证安全性,而且其运行效率明显高于SC-MD5和SC-SHA算法.

关 键 词:序列密码  单分组散列函数  哈希链  运行效率  安全性

Stream cipher algorithm based on Hash chain
JIANG Xuan,LI Yongzhen.Stream cipher algorithm based on Hash chain[J].Journal of Yanbian University (Natural Science),2015,0(3):249-253.
Authors:JIANG Xuan  LI Yongzhen
Affiliation:JIANG Xuan, LI Yongzhen*
Abstract:We proposed a new stream cipher in this article to apply in the wireless mobile communications, new stream cipher implemented by Single-Block hash function based on Hash chain method. In this new algorithm, the Single-Block hash function processes loop operation adopted Hash chain method firstly, then links the output of each operation into the Stream Cipher key sequence, finally cipher text is obtained by bit XOR operation of plaintext and key sequence. After the realization of SC-SBH, we have tested its randomness and security, and have made comparison with SC-MD5 and SC-SHA in efficiency. The experimental results showed that the SC-SBH algorithm not only can ensure safety, but also have high efficiency relative to SC-MD5 and SC-SHA.
Keywords:stream cipher  Single-Block hash function  Hash chain  running efficiency  security
本文献已被 CNKI 等数据库收录!
点击此处可从《延边大学理工学报》浏览原始摘要信息
点击此处可从《延边大学理工学报》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号